Python编程:从入门到精通的100题实践挑战
4星 · 超过85%的资源 需积分: 48 141 浏览量
更新于2024-07-18
19
收藏 735KB PDF 举报
"Python从菜鸟到大神的100道经典练习题,涵盖了基础到进阶的编程训练,旨在帮助初学者通过实践提升Python技能。这些题目包括了数组操作、逻辑判断、数学计算等多个方面,适合对Python感兴趣的学习者进行自我挑战。"
在这100道经典练习题中,我们可以看到两个具体的示例:
1. 题目1是一个关于排列组合的问题,它要求生成所有不重复的三位数。这个练习主要涉及循环和条件判断。通过三层for循环遍历1到4的数字,然后使用if语句排除重复的情况,打印出符合条件的三位数。这个题目可以帮助初学者理解如何使用循环和条件语句解决实际问题,同时锻炼了对数组和索引的操作。
2. 题目2涉及到奖金计算,这是一个基于利润的分段函数问题,需要根据不同的利润区间计算对应的奖金比例。这个问题要求编程者理解如何用程序实现分段函数,并处理边界条件。程序通过定义不同利润区间的奖金,然后根据输入的利润值选择合适的计算方法。这道题目的解决方法涵盖了变量、输入/输出、条件分支以及数值计算,对初学者理解Python的控制流和数据处理非常有帮助。
这两道题目体现了Python编程的基础元素,包括循环结构(for循环)、条件判断(if...else)、变量定义以及用户输入处理。同时,它们也展示了如何将实际问题转化为计算机可以理解的逻辑。通过解决这些练习,学习者不仅可以巩固基础语法,还能提升逻辑思维能力,逐步成长为Python的大神。
为了更好地掌握Python编程,不仅要理解和解答这些练习题,还需要不断练习,尝试解决更多实际问题,如数据分析、网络爬虫、自动化脚本等。同时,不断探索Python的高级特性,如类与对象、模块化编程、异常处理等,以及了解和使用各种Python库,如Numpy、Pandas和Matplotlib等,这将有助于深化对Python的理解和应用。
2010-04-21 上传
2021-10-01 上传
2020-09-09 上传
2023-06-11 上传
点击了解资源详情
点击了解资源详情
dailele
- 粉丝: 5
- 资源: 34
最新资源
- 新代数控API接口实现CNC数据采集技术解析
- Java版Window任务管理器的设计与实现
- 响应式网页模板及前端源码合集:HTML、CSS、JS与H5
- 可爱贪吃蛇动画特效的Canvas实现教程
- 微信小程序婚礼邀请函教程
- SOCR UCLA WebGis修改:整合世界银行数据
- BUPT计网课程设计:实现具有中继转发功能的DNS服务器
- C# Winform记事本工具开发教程与功能介绍
- 移动端自适应H5网页模板与前端源码包
- Logadm日志管理工具:创建与删除日志条目的详细指南
- 双日记微信小程序开源项目-百度地图集成
- ThreeJS天空盒素材集锦 35+ 优质效果
- 百度地图Java源码深度解析:GoogleDapper中文翻译与应用
- Linux系统调查工具:BashScripts脚本集合
- Kubernetes v1.20 完整二进制安装指南与脚本
- 百度地图开发java源码-KSYMediaPlayerKit_Android库更新与使用说明